I know this is painfully obvious and you probably already knew.....but, were the old batteries corroded at all? Be sure to check the battery contacts in the probe and make sure they are clean with no corrosion. If you see any discoloration, use a small strip of very fine sand paper (i.e. 600) to clean them. If the contacts are recessed and hard to reach, tape the sandpaper to the eraser end of a pencil, or similar, to do the cleaning.
